Durant fires back at Perkins over bold Thunder claims

Kevin Durant didn’t hold back when responding to former teammate Kendrick Perkins’ bold claim about his leadership on the Oklahoma City Thunder, as the Phoenix Suns’ All-Star forward rubbished his suggestion the ESPN analyst was the leader of the team.

The NBA pundit stated he was the true leader of the team that featured Durant, Russell Westbrook, and James Harden from 2011 to 2015, a time when the Thunder were known for their trio of future Hall of Famers.

For years, the team’s core of Durant, Westbrook, and Harden was one of the most dominant young groups in the NBA although Perkins, best remembered for his role with the 2008 Boston Celtics, played 275 games for the Thunder, averaging 4.2 points per game.

The 40-year-old then shocked headlines by claiming he “was the one leading along with Nick Collison“, something the Suns star wasted no time in shutting down as he took to X.com, formerly Twitter, on Thursday.

Durant quote-tweeted Perkins‘ remarks and writing, “I know this may be a reach but this comment is by far the craziest s–t I’ve seen this week.”

Perkins’ controversial comments in full

Perkins‘ comments came during a discussion about Durant‘s current situation with the Suns ahead of the NBA trade deadline.

With Phoenix struggling this season, trade rumors had swirled around Durant, though he ultimately remained with the team, reportedly turning down the possibility of returning to the Golden State Warriors.

Whilst particularly speaking about Durant‘s leadership, Perkins dismissed the idea that the team’s best player is always the leader and pointed to his own examples from within his own career.

“I said Kevin Durant, another organization, another failure. I didn’t say it was his fault. This is a failed season,” Perkins said on ESPN. “I’d been on so many teams with so many Hall of Famers.

“On the Celtics team, everybody will probably think (Kevin Garnett) was the leader. He wasn’t the leader. You know who the leader was? It was James Posey. So, every single team doesn’t mean your best player is the leader.

“When I was with the Oklahoma City Thunder, it wasn’t KD, it wasn’t Russ, it wasn’t James. I was the one leading along with Nick Collison.

“You replace LeBron and KD, and you give LeBron Bradley Beal and Devin Booker, and they wouldn’t be sitting at (25-25).”
